Downtown Improvement District Announces Window Decorating Contest Winner

The Downtown Improvement District is excited to announce that for the inaugural year of its Downtown Holiday Window Decorating contest over 700 people voted for their favorite window display, and winning 11% of the vote was Creative Women of the World! Thirty-one organizations participated in this year’s contest with the theme “Yesteryear”, making it a resounding, run-away success.

Creative Women of the World has been a Downtown staple for several years. It provides business training and marketing solutions to women around the world rising out of extreme poverty, human trafficking, and tragic disaster, through the power of their own creativity. They sell unique and responsibly-sourced products from around the world making them a one-of-a-kind shopping experience not only in Downtown, but in the entire region.

Creative Women of the World has been a community steward and helped lead the resurgence of retail in Downtown Fort Wayne. Their window celebrating diversity and beautiful goods available from around the world reflects the belief that Downtown is everyone’s neighborhood. Indeed, according to Lorelai VerLee, the founder and Executive Director of Creative Women of the World, the window display has been so inspirational for the store that they now plan to have window displays year-round.

Holiday window decorating is a tradition that had largely disappeared from Downtown for many decades after the losses of Wolf and Dessauer, Murphy’s, and other large anchor stores. With the loss of these stores it appeared that the magical memories they created with their window displays would cease to be created for thousands more of Fort Wayne’s citizens. However, like window decorating, retail is making a triumphant return to Downtown Fort Wayne—Holly Trolley Shopping recently had 70 stores participate in the one-day Downtown shopping event. Holiday Window Decorating Contest 2015:

HolidayFest in Downtown Fort Wayne is always the center of holiday activity in the region, and this year, the Downtown Improvement District added another opportunity for holiday fun that is sure to become a tradition in years ahead. The Downtown Holiday Window Decorating Contest is the chance for any Downtown business, organization, restaurant, etc. to join in the holiday cheer by decorating their window. Participation in the contest was completely free and windows simply needed to be done by the Night of Lights—when voting began. While thousands of people flocked to Downtown to see Santa and His Reindeer and the other lighting displays lit up for the season, they walked from one festive window to another only multiplying the magic of the evening.
